So I have a computer that is a few years old and I get low-medium fps rates on medium-high graphics. I'm looking to upgrade some parts

Specs:
Cpu - i5-2320 3ghz
Gpu - Radeon HD 6670
Ram - 8gb 640MHz
HDD - 2tb 7200rpm

If I were to upgrade this build I would salvage the cpu, hdd and disc drive.
And then upgrade the motherboard, ram, gpu and get an ssd.

Upgrading your board and RAM would be a waste of money. Your CPU is locked, your RAM speed is fine (1333 MT/s, ~665 MHz), and you have the PCIe 16x slot.
